Check your VIN # for balance shaft issue

Make sure your VIN is not within the range for the settled Class Action Suit on the Engine Balance Shaft. I have the same car & mine was included. The check Engine light went on at 65k with the code indicating a balance shaft problem. MB paid for part of the repair after I complained A LOT. During the same visit, I also found out there is a problem with the transfer case after replacing the oil 1 month prior. So, $10k worth of repairs were needed! I bought my car CPO & only put 22k on the it in 4 yrs. My 1-year warranty expired. I had the balance shaft repaired & only had to pay about $1k out of pocket because of MB's goodwill policy. I don't think any of us should have to pay anything for known malfunctioning parts.

The Transfer case issue has not been repaired yet. MB dealer is telling me the problem is more of an "annoyance" than anything & that he has never known anyone's car to have broken down because of this issue. My car vibrates when turning at low speeds & jumps in the lower gears. It feels like a standard car with a driver that doesn't know how to shift properly. When I was waiting at the dealership, I heard call after call about bad transfer cases that needed to be repaired. Seems like there needs to be another suit regarding the many bad transfer cases.

If I could do it all over again, I would have purchased the extended warranty when it was offered. Good luck with your car--hope you don't have the same issues down the road!

It's funny you mention this now, as this thread is about a year old.

I had all of those problems. Every one you listed.

The car was in the shop for almost 6 months doing repairs by some shady mechanic. Didn't cost me anything because it was under warranty, but the car will never be the same again.

I'm currently having the exact problem you mentioned, and I never thought of the transfer case until recently. Or at least, I didn't think it'd be related to the shifting problem.

My car makes almost a grinding noise when going around turns. I can't hear it unless the window is open. Makes sense that it'd be a transfer case issue. The car is out of warranty now, so depending on the complexity these may be repairs I do myself.
